The Zimbabwe Young Warriors saved face after bowing out of the COSAFA Under- 20 Championship with a thumping 4-1 win over Lesotho at the Gelvandale stadium in South Africa this Tuesday
Having started the match with their fate out of their hands but still with a chance of progressing to the semi-finals, the Young Warriors got off to a good start and took the lead in the 19th minute courtesy of an own goal by Lethalo Monyaka.
Tawanda Mandivenga would soon find the back of the net, just 3 minutes later and with 10 minutes to go before halftime Kudzai Mangiza made sure the game was safe.
However, Lesotho pulled one goal back in added time before the breather.
In the second half, it was more of consolidation and Prince Edward forward Bill Antonio restored the 3 goal cushion for the Young Warriors and they would hold on to win the match 4-1.
The Tonderai Ndiraya-coached side now returns home, while the top two sides in the group Mozambique and hosts South Africa proceed to the semi-finals which get underway this Thursday.
